Apa Itu NPU Pada Prosesor untuk AI?

Admin

Anda tentunya sudah kenal dengan yang namanya Central Processing Unit (CPU) atau Graphic Processing Unit (GPU) di dalam komputer desktop ataupun laptop. Nah, belakangan ini, ada istilah baru yang mendadak populer, yakni NPU.

Apa itu NPU? Apa fungsinya di dalam computer desktop ataupun laptop? Kali ini kita akan sedikit mengulas tentang Neural Processing Unit atau NPU yang mulai hadir di prosesor PC desktop dan laptop di akhir 2023 dan akan semakin marak dikembangkan di masa depan.

Seperti disebut di atas, NPU adalah singkatan dari Neural Processing Unit. Ia merupakan sebuah chip pengolah data yang bisa mempercepat algoritma Machine Learning alias artificial intelligence (AI). 



Chip ini dibuat khusus untuk bisa menjalankan model prediktif atau model yang menggunakan data saat ini untuk membuat prediksi di masa depan. NPU juga dikenal sebagai neural processor dan dirancang khusus untuk kecerdasan buatan di perangkat yang terhubung ke internet (IoT) atau tidak.

Fungsi NPU sendiri adalah untuk mempercepat operasi perhitungan model jaringan saraf dan memecahkan masalah ketidakefisienan chip tradisional dalam operasi jaringan saraf.

Contoh Manfaat NPU dalam Aktivitas Pengguna
NPU banyak digunakan dalam berbagai aplikasi seperti pengenalan gambar, pengolahan bahasa alami, pengenalan suara, dan fungsi AI lainnya. Contoh penggunaan NPU adalah sebagai berikut:

  • NPU dapat membantu smartphone dalam melakukan tugas-tugas berbasis AI seperti mengambil foto dengan mode potret, menerjemahkan teks secara real-time, atau mengoptimalkan kinerja baterai.
  • NPU dapat membantu laptop dalam melakukan tugas-tugas berbasis AI seperti mengedit video, mengubah suara menjadi teks atau sebaliknya, atau mengenali wajah pengguna untuk login.
  • NPU dapat membantu perangkat IoT dalam melakukan tugas-tugas berbasis AI seperti mengontrol lampu pintar, mendeteksi gerakan, atau mengirim notifikasi ke pengguna.
  • NPU menggunakan arsitektur “data-driven parallel computing”. Iasangat baik dalam memproses data multimedia masif seperti video dan gambar. Selain itu, NPU juga mampu melakukan perhitungan matematika yang kompleks yang diperlukan untuk jaringan saraf buatan. Prosesnya juga lebih cepat dan hemat energi daripada CPU atau GPU tradisional. Di dalamnya ada modul khusus untuk operasi perkalian dan penambahan, fungsi aktivasi, operasi data 2D, dekompresi, dan lain-lain.

NPU sendiri banyak digunakan dalam berbagai aplikasi seperti pengenalan gambar, pengolahan bahasa alami, pengenalan suara, dan fungsi AI lainnya. Contoh, kalau di PC Anda ada NPU di dalam GPU, NPU bisa dioptimalkan untuk tugas tertentu seperti deteksi objek atau percepatan gambar.

Baca juga:


Dibuat Hybrid dengan GPU
Saat ini konsep GPNPU (GPU-NPU hybrid) juga muncul. Ia bertujuan untuk menggabungkan kekuatan GPU dan NPU. GPNPU memanfaatkan kemampuan pemrosesan paralel GPU sambil mengintegrasikan arsitektur NPU.

Tujuannya untuk mempercepat tugas-tugas berbasis AI. Kombinasi ini bertujuan untuk mencapai keseimbangan antara fleksibilitas dan pemrosesan AI khusus. Termasuk melayani kebutuhan komputasi yang beragam dalam satu chip.

NPU adalah teknologi yang menjanjikan untuk masa depan AI. Dengan NPU, aplikasi AI dapat berjalan lebih cepat, lebih akurat, dan lebih hemat daya. NPU juga dapat membuka peluang baru untuk inovasi dan kreativitas dalam bidang AI.

Nah, sekarang Anda sudah lebih mengenal NPU. Pastikan Anda mengikuti perkembangan informasi terkait teknologi ini karena ia akan sangat erat hubungannya di komputasi masa depan, khususnya yang terkait dengan artificial intelligence.